
Spirit of Scotland Allt A Bhainne 2016 is a bold and expressive Speyside single cask whisky that offers a rare opportunity to explore the character of a distillery more commonly found within blended Scotch production. Allt A Bhainne is known for producing malt that plays an important supporting role in some of the world’s most recognised blends, making independent bottlings like this particularly interesting for those who want to experience its spirit in a more direct and unfiltered form.
Part of the Spirit of Scotland range by James Gordon Whisky Co. Ltd. in Elgin, this release is focused on showcasing individual casks in their purest expression. Distilled in 2016 and matured for 8 years in a refill bourbon barrel, this cask strength whisky has been bottled un chill filtered and with no added colour. With only 232 bottles available, it represents a small and focused snapshot of the distillery’s output at a specific point in time.
The refill bourbon cask allows the spirit character to remain at the forefront, supported rather than overshadowed by wood influence. Expect a profile that leans into Speyside’s typically bright and malty character, with layers of orchard fruit, light vanilla sweetness, and gentle citrus lift. There is a natural vibrancy to the whisky, balanced by a subtle oak presence that adds structure without heaviness. The cask strength delivery gives it energy and intensity, while still maintaining clarity and drinkability when approached with care.
